SAMOTHRACE “Reverence To Stone” – 2 Songs Of Epic Doom Metal; Unleashes A Massive Atmosphere Of Doom


SAMOTHRACEReverence To Stone may only feature two songs, however, it’s the length and overall magnitude of Doom Metal that is of Metal importance here. We’re talking about a massive atmosphere of Doom Metal I feel and hear from Reverence To Stone. Released back on July 31st, via 20 Buck Spin, Reverence To Stone has my nomination for epic Metal album of the year.

When We Emerged clocks in at 14:20 and A Horse Of Our Own plays at a mega memorable 20:29. Nearly 35 minutes of 100% Doom saturation. A massive, massive wall of Doom imbued sound. Both guitar and percussive driven, coupled with the unforgiving exclusion to multiple tracks here, are what encourages Samothrace to delve deep into the cavernous depths of Doom awareness.

Doom Metal fans from coast-to-coast and across continents should take note: Samothrace = A DOOM listening experience. You can’t possibly listen to Reverence To Stone two or three times and draw a conclusion. You must listen to these two epic songs several times before realizing that Samothrace cares that their music (and growls) are telling a story; and most importantly, Samothrace brilliantly piece together the parts of music that are essential to the essence (of the totality) of Doom sound. I’m overjoyed by this Samothrace album. Metal be thy name.
